If a private school ends operations in Maryland, the institution must file with the state's superintendent of schools the original or a legible copy of all secondary school transcripts for each student who has been enrolled in grades 9 through 12 of the school. County boards of education must provide or arrange for the transportation of handicapped students publicly placed in nonpublic schools. The records will become a permanent file maintained by the state's superintendent of schools' office to provide an academic record as required by postsecondary educational institutions for admission. Standards for the education of those children enrolled in programs operated by agencies other than a county board must be as high as the standards for county board programs. The Maryland Nonpublic Student Textbook program provides "funding for the purchase of textbooks, computer hardware and computer software for loan to students in eligible nonpublic schools, with a maximum distribution of $60 per eligible nonpublic school student for participating schools, except that at schools where at least 20 percent of the students are eligible for free and reduced price lunch program, the distribution will be $90 per student. Nonpublic schools must establish a policy to permit school employees to administer auto-injectable epinephrine, if available, to a student who is known to be or thought to be in anaphylaxis. The state board of education requires each private school to report annually, on or before Aug, 31, the school's enrollment and courses of study on forms provided by the Board. Approved nonpublic high schools must be prepared to present a transcript of the secondary school record of each student for each year enrolled that contains specified components: school's name, address, and telephone number; student's first, middle, and last names; student's date of birth; student's home address; credits and grades earned in each subject area; code for the meaning of the grading system; transfer credits accepted by the secondary school; month, day, and year the student initially entered; month, day, and year the student withdrew or graduated; and number of days of attendance each school year.
